As you can see in the list above, most of the gaming monitors feature a TN panel while photo editing monitors and regular consumer monitors have IPS panels. The reason behind this is that TN panels allow for a quick 1ms response time which entirely eliminates ghosting of the fast moving objects in the fast-paced, competitive FPS games. However, they also produce less accurate colors as well as less wide viewing angles which result in colors contrasting when viewed from different angles.
Besides offering precise and consistent colors, the IPS panel monitors also deliver the impeccable viewing angles of degrees and solid 4ms response time that although may not be quick enough for professional players, it is sufficient for the average gamer. The difference between a 60Hz and a Hz monitor is huge, there is no doubt about it. However, when it comes to Hz vs Hz, there are more things you should take into account.
Granted that there is absolutely no screen tearing present in comparison to some minor visible tearing on Hz monitors, it still requires quite a demanding and expensive computer setup which makes them suited only for the high-end professional FPS gamers. Lastly, choose the right resolution for you. The p resolution on a inch monitor provides sufficient desktop space and crisp image quality for high-quality gaming and movie watching experience. Although a p resolution is more popular among inch monitors, on a inch screen it will provide plenty of space and will most likely be scaled, depending on the personal preference of an individual user, which will again result in highly detailed picture quality.
